The Samsung 96GB DDR5-5600MHz ECC Registered RDIMM is a high-capacity memory module designed for servers and workstations that require reliable and fast memory. It fits into 288-pin slots and uses ECC to keep data accurate while running at an efficient 1.1 volts. |

Technical Information |
|
|---|---|
| Memory Capacity | 96GB |
| Memory Technology | DDR5 |
| RAM Standard | PC5-44800 |
| Pin Count | 288-Pin |
| Error Correction | ECC |
| Rank | 2Rx4 |
| Voltage | 1.1V |
Performance |
|
|---|---|
| Bus Speed | 5600 MT/s |
| Bandwidth | 44800 MB/s |
| Native Speed | 5600 MHz |
| CAS | CL46 |
